UNIFORM ALLOTMENT. Section 21.01. The City shall furnish all authorized uniforms and equipment to uniformed personnel. All items furnished by the City shall be returned to the City upon termination of the Employee’s employment.
Section 21.02. The City shall be responsible for furnishing and dry cleaning of each sworn Employee uniform on a regular basis.
Section 21.03. All non-uniformed Employees, (Detectives) shall receive, in lieu of the uniform allotment above-described, clothing allowance in the amount of $45.00 per pay period during the period this Agreement remains in effect. Additionally all Detectives will receive one (1) full summer and one (1) full winter uniform.
UNIFORM ALLOTMENT. 9.2.1 The uniform allocation for new hires shall consist of four (4) pairs of uniform trousers and four (4) uniform shirts and all required leather gear, including but not limited to, inner duty belt, outer duty belt, duty holster, handcuff case, and magazine pouch. One (1) winter coat shall be issued upon initial employment and subsequently replaced every five (5) years thereafter.
9.2.2 Each calendar year after the employee’s year of hire, each employee shall be issued a uniform allotment voucher worth the equivalent of the value of two (2) pairs of uniform trousers and two (2) long-sleeve uniform shirts, as determined by the prices specified in the current uniform supply contract obtained through the City’s bidding process, which may be used by the employee to acquire replacement uniform trousers, shirts, belts, shoes or other uniform attire from the Department or approved vendor. There shall not be any cash payment to the employee for any unused portion of the uniform voucher, nor shall any unused voucher amount be carried over to the next calendar year.

UNIFORM ALLOTMENT. All current employees and new hires shall receive an initial uniform and equipment allotment, as set forth in “Appendix D,” attached hereto and made a part of this Agreement, at no cost to the employee. In the event the Town or Police Chief requires additional uniforms and/or equipment, the Town shall provide, at no cost to the employee, those articles. Thereafter, those articles shall become part of “Appendix D” for issue to new and existing employees. All equipment issued by the Town shall be returned to the Town upon the employee’s separation from service. In the event the employee does not return his/her equipment, the employee’s last paycheck shall have that amount deducted for replacement, and in the event that paycheck is insufficient based on fair market replacement, the employee shall be required to pay the Town the balance due. All uniforms and equipment shall be replaced by the Town based on a normal wear and tear basis.
UNIFORM ALLOTMENT. All custodians, maintenance employees, and mechanics shall be provided uniforms.
18.2.1 After the completion of the probationary period, the Board will provide three (3) uniforms for all newly employed building custodians and building maintenance personnel. Thereafter, three (3) uniforms and two (2) t-shirts will be provided each year. Non-building maintenance personnel will also be provided two (2) t-shirts each year. Employees shall wear these uniforms/t-shirts while on duty.
18.2.2 Mechanics and non-building maintenance personnel will be provided a uniform service which will provide five (5) clean uniforms per week. Such employees shall wear these uniforms while on duty.
UNIFORM ALLOTMENT. 1. The Employer shall provide a uniform allotment to each full-time and part-time Emergency Communications Nurse, by establishing and maintaining a quartermaster system of uniform issuance as outlined below, for the duration of this Collective Agreement. Full-time ECN Staff Six (6) shirts, four (4) pairs of tactical pants, four (4) pairs of epaulette sleeves, one
(1) winter hat, one (1) pair of safety footwear, one (1) belt, one (1) sweater, one (1) spring/fall jacket, one (1) pair of gloves. Part-time ECN Staff Five (5) shirts, four (4) pairs of tactical pants, two (2) pairs of epaulette sleeves, one
(1) winter hat, one (1) pair of safety footwear, one (1) belt, one (1) sweater, one (1) spring/fall jacket, one (1) pair of gloves When a part-time staff member becomes full-time, they will be entitled to the differential of full-time annual allotment.
2. On an annual basis worn out, improperly sized or irreparably damaged items shall be exchanged on a one-for-one basis through the quartermaster system of uniform allotment; however exchange shall be no greater than the allotment as outlined above. It is also understood that items may be exchanged on an exception basis if they are worn out or irreparably damaged. Employees may be responsible for replacement cost if damage or wear on the items is not the result of normal work related wear and tear.
3. This provision is subject to modification based on recommendations of the NEMS Uniform and Health and Safety Committees and approval by the Corporation.
